Output c75831cf3769a6f96ae0b4d3051fd9ff12920fc5f118ec43ba1e8fd0a14f7a0c:11

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08f75703da645ec10e130798e15476cb1e8745a OP_EQUAL
address
3LhnL8eqQBU8nRqXvE4FpdQVTrig2HuBzz
transaction
c75831cf3769a6f96ae0b4d3051fd9ff12920fc5f118ec43ba1e8fd0a14f7a0c
spent
true